Einfügen von Daten in Oracle-Tabellen in Oracle über SQL-Developer
Um Daten in Oracle-Tabellen mit SQL-Plus einzufügen, müssen Sie am Server angemeldet sein. Daten können über die INSERT-Anweisung zu Tabellen hinzugefügt werden.
Denken Sie daran, dass dadurch Daten zeilenweise eingefügt werden. Sie können Ihre INSERT-Anweisungen in Notepad oder einem ähnlichen Editor erstellen und in den SQL-Plus-Editor kopieren. Sie müssen den Befehl run für jede Einfügung ausgeben.,
Da Ihre Daten größtenteils keine fehlenden Werte enthalten, sollten Sie in der Lage sein, die INSERT-Anweisung nur mit der VALUES-Klausel zu verwenden und nicht alle Spalten anzugeben., Denken Sie beim Einrichten Ihrer INSERT-Anweisungen daran, dass
- Zeichendaten durch einfache Anführungszeichen begrenzt werden sollten
- numerische Daten sollten nicht durch einfache Anführungszeichen getrennt werden
- Nullwerte können mit NULL eingegeben werden (nicht in Anführungszeichen gesetzt)
- Daten sollten mit einem DD-MON-YY-Format mit einfachen Anführungszeichen oder über eine TO_DATE-Funktion
- alle durch Kommas zu trennenden Werte
Im folgenden Beispiel wird das DD-MON-YY-Format.,
Wenn Sie Daten in einem konventionelleren Format eingeben möchten, müssen Sie alternativ die Funktion TO_DATE verwenden und ein Format angeben, wie unten dargestellt.
Um Daten mit Zeiten einzugeben, müssen Sie die Funktion TO_DATE verwenden, wie in:
- Minuten werden als ‚MI‘ und nicht als ‚MM‘ bezeichnet (was für Monate reserviert ist). Falls Sie Sekunden verwenden müssen, werden diese als “ SS “ bezeichnet.,
- Stunden befinden sich auf einer Skala von 1-12 und benötigen möglicherweise einen AM – oder PM-Bezeichner, um den entsprechenden Meridian anzuzeigen. Sie können dies umgehen, indem Sie eine 24-Stunden-Uhr verwenden, wie unten dargestellt.